Job description

About the company

Hospitable builds software that helps short-term rental businesses operate more independently, backed by a polished product and a strong user experience. The company is fully remote, global, and built on trust. It values exceptional people from different backgrounds, geographies, and career paths, and sees that diversity as a core strength. The team works quickly, thinks ambitiously, and ships with purpose.

The business is profitable, international, and structured across multiple entities. The finance leader will report directly to the CEO and will play a central role in shaping the company’s growth, discipline, and long-term value.

Role overview

The company is hiring a Chief Financial Officer to provide top-tier financial leadership and help transform finance into a growth driver. The role is focused on backing the right investments, scaling the business responsibly, and creating durable value for both the team and investors.

What you will own

Capital and growth

  • Take ownership of capital allocation and build the internal and external case for the investments that matter most.
  • Equip leadership with the insight needed to invest confidently while keeping operations profitable as they scale.

The company’s financial future

  • Strengthen the company’s long-term value and the liquidity opportunities that come with it for employees and investors.
  • Represent the company’s finances externally as the main point of contact for investors, partners, banks, and auditors.

A world-class finance function

  • Design, hire, and lead a lean finance organization that uses AI effectively across an international group structure.
  • Define how finance should operate, how it should support the business, and how it earns trust across the company.

Working style and expectations

This is a remote-only role within a distributed organization. A strong day-to-day overlap with both EMEA and US Eastern time zones is required. The role reports to the CEO.

Candidate profile

The company is open to candidates who may not match every requirement, as long as they can clearly explain why they are a strong fit. The team is looking for someone who has led finance at real scale, created long-term value for shareholders, and worked in complex international settings with multiple entities and currencies.

Strong experience with cross-border tax and compliance is important, including US indirect tax. A recognized accounting qualification such as ACCA, ACA, CIMA, or a locally accredited CPA is expected, along with solid FP&A and financial modelling capability. Success in this role also depends on being highly proactive, owning outcomes, communicating clearly, and working independently in a fast-moving remote environment.

Preferred background

  • Experience with SaaS-enabled marketplaces, including forecasting both transactional GBV and recurring revenue.
  • Exposure to the travel, hospitality, or proptech industries.
  • Experience building a finance team from a founder-led setup into a more institutional-grade function.
